Output 90fee520c286a8354d9de0292ffee63360e5305e83beedd51a53fc8b7766df30:0

value
12940750810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59b1710a03d229f35798b47e97459aa59a4cd191 OP_EQUAL
address
39sGdUM9pEVG74cw6Fo32fJDWxjZ8YWbLM
transaction
90fee520c286a8354d9de0292ffee63360e5305e83beedd51a53fc8b7766df30
spent
true